  • Patent number: 6710964
    Abstract: The present invention is directed to a ramp load disc drive storage system having improved loading performance and a reduced likelihood of failure due to stiction and damage caused by contact between a slider and a disc surface during ramp load operations. The slider generally includes wear-resistive pads which allow for improved loading performance and reduce stiction between the slider and a disc surface. The pads also allow the ramp load disc drive storage system to be operated in a ramp load/unload mode or a contact start/stop mode. Additionally, a method of operating a ramp load disc drive is provided where the slider is loaded above a disc surface from a ramp prior to the disc reaching a full operating speed.

  • Patent number: 4377830
    Abstract: A combination magnetic disk storage device and filter system for internally recirculating filtered air and reducing foreign particle contamination in the shroud area of a magnetic disk unit. The storage device and system having an air filter placed between an enclosed fixed disk and a removable disk received in a disk cartridge. By spinning the disks for a predetermined time prior to using the disk drive unit, the disks coact with the filter in circulating and filtering the air in the disk housing and the disk enclosures to substantially reduce the particle count to prevent read-write head crashes.

  • Patent number: 4310864
    Abstract: An improvement to allow easier detaching of a disk memory module from its magnetic attachment to the spindle of a front loading disk drive. In one such type of drive, manually pulling a door open actuates a track-mounted carrier which lifts the disk module from the spindle, breaking the magnetic attraction between them, and transporting the module to the open door for manual removal. To reduce the force necessary to break the magnetic attraction, this invention employs an actuator fixed to the carrier which engages a crank mechanism when the carrier is being pulled to the opening. The crank mechanism pushes against the underside of the module and assists its breaking loose from the spindle. A spring holds the crank assembly in position to re-engage the actuator when the carrier is in the module-detached position.
